HP Pavilion x360 Convertible Laptop PC 14-dh0516sa
Microsoft Windows 10 (64-bit)

I'm trying to replace the m.2 SSD with a 2.5' one but I understand a model specific cable/adaptor is required.

Can anyone tell which cable this is as I'm lost.

It does not make any sense at all. Normally we replace HDD to get a better performance but is your case you wish to get a slower disk.

 

By the way, your machine supports dual storage with M.2 SSD + 2.5" HDD. It has  128 GB M.2 SSD (SATA) now, you can add 2.5" HDD/SSD to your machine using standard 2.5" SSD's on market today, for example

 

              https://www.samsung.com/au/memory-storage/sata-ssd/870-evo-500gb-sata-3-2-5-ssd-mz-77e500bw/

 

You also need  one of the following 2 parts:

 

  • Hard drive cover for use in models without a fingerprint reader part # L51121-001
  • Hard drive cover for use in models with a fingerprint reader part # L51122-001

Please use page37 of the following manual for more information (how to install HDD).
